Impact Mapping is a lightweight planning technique that helps organisations align delivery with business goals. It is collaborative, visual, and most importantly fast.
In this talk, Gojko presents early results of an ongoing research on how teams around the world apply impact mapping to speed up time to market and get maximum impact for minimum effort. You'll learn about five important ideas to ensure effective impact mapping sessions.

Gojko Adzic
Gojko is a partner at Neuri Consulting LLP. He is the winner of the 2016 European Software Testing Outstanding Achievement Award, and the 2011 Most Influential Agile Testing Professional Award. Gojko's book Specification by Example won the Jolt Award for the Best Book of 2012, and his blog won the UK Agile Award for the best outline publication in 2010. Gojko is a frequent speaker at software development conferences, including NDC, Agile Days, Oredev, and YOW!, and is one of the authors of MindMup and Claudia.js.
